Pests & vectors

Springtails and other small substrate insects

Jumping specks and surface grazing require identification and evidence of damage. Not every organism found near a crop is its primary problem.

Organism / cause: Collembola and other organisms requiring identification

Where this evidence applies: A broad pest differential, especially where substrate contacts soil or wet organic residues.

01 · Observe

What you may see

  • Small jumping organisms on damp surfaces or substrate.
  • Possible superficial feeding or contamination of the harvest.

02 · Compare

What can look similar

  • Mites, small flies and unrelated incidental insects.
How it may arise or move

Soil, organic residues and incoming material are practical places to investigate.

03 · Check

Collect evidence before changing the crop

  1. Record behaviour and damage separately.
  2. Inspect paths from outdoor soil and stored organic material into production.

What confirmation needs: Entomological identification prevents incorrect treatment of mites as springtails or vice versa.

04 · Respond

What to do next

  1. Keep affected harvest separate while identifying the organism.
  2. Address entry and breeding habitat before escalating chemical control.

These are investigation and containment steps, not a guaranteed cure. Do not eat, sell or distribute suspect material on the strength of a visual match. Do not culture unknown contaminants or experiment with pesticides in a growing room.

05 · Learn

Reduce recurrence

  • Limit soil transfer on footwear and equipment.
  • Clear wet residues and maintain hygienic storage.

After intervention, compare new affected units, crop condition and inspection results against the same recorded baseline. A lack of visible growth does not, by itself, verify decontamination or food safety.
